2. BACKGROUND
We refer to the communication with the Borrower, whereby the Borrower has informed the Bank that it will be unable to fully allocate ali amounts by 31 December 2023 — the deadline currently set out in Article 1 .9A (Allocation Procedure) of the Finance Contracts (the “Notified Event”).
2.1. As a result of the Notified Event, pursuant to the terms of the Finance Contracts, the Bank would, be entitled to demand the compulsory prepayment of the Loan Outstanding in accordance with Article 4.3 (Compulsory Prepayment) of the Finance Contracts.
2.2. ln Iight of the above, the Borrower has requested the Bank to waive and amend certain provisions of the Finance Contracts, as further described below.
3. WAIVER
With effect from the Effective Date, the Bank waives its rights to, as a result of the Notified Event, demand demand the compulsory prepayment of the Loan Outstanding in accordance with Articie 4.3 (CompulsoryPrepayment) of the Finance Contract of the Finance Contracts, arising from a failure by the Borrower to fully aliocate the amounts under the respective Finance Contract by the deadline specified in Article 1 .9A (Allocation Procedure) of the Finance Contracts.
4. AMENDMENTS TO THE FINANCE CONTRACTS
With effect from the Effective Date, the Finance Contracts shall be amended as set out below.
4.1. Article 1 .9A (Allocation Procedure) of the Finance Contracts shail be amended to read as follows:
“1.9A Allocation Procedure
The Borrower shall submit to the Bank for approval requests for allocation (the “Allocation Request”) by 30 June 2024, or in the case of Schemes allocated under the COVID-19 Component as per Schedule A (bis) by 30 September 2022, which may at the discretion of the Bank be extended.
The Credit shall only be allocated to Schemes identified as eligible for financing in the Technical Description applicable to it and in accordance with the provisions set out in Article 6.5 and 6.6 below. In order to qualify for financing hereunder, each Scheme must meet the relevant criteria and parameters applied by the Bank to the type of Scheme concerned.
The Bank funds comprising the Loan shall be allocated as follows:
(a) without prejudice to 6.5(e)(iv) and (v), Schemes with an aggregate investment cost below EUR 25,000,000 (twenty-five million euros) may be selected by the Borrower. The Borrower shall provide an Allocation Request in the form set out in Schedule A.1.6 including the selected Schemes to the Bank. The Allocation Request shall be subsequently confirmed by the Bank;
(b) Schemes with an investment cost between EUR 25,000,000 (twenty-five million euros) and EUR 50,000,000 (fifty million euros) shali be submitted ex-ante to the Bank for approval. The Borrower shall provide an Allocation Request in the form set out in Schedule A.1 .7 including the Schemes proposed to the Bank. The Bank reserves the right to (i) request additional information from the Borrower and (ii) if deemed necessary, perform a partial or an in-depth appraisal of the Schemes;
(c) Schemes with an investment cost above EUR 50,000,000 (fifty million euros) shail be submitted ex-ante to the Bank for appraisal and approval according to the Bank internal rules and procedures. The Borrower shall present such
2
Corporate Use
Schemes to the Bank for separate appraisal and approval. In case the said Scheme falis within the meaning of art. 100 of the CPR, the Borrower shall present the major project application form as required from the CPR together with relevant studies, the independent quality review and the Commission’s decision on the approval of the major project, if aiready approved;
(d) Schemes for the production of bio fueis, regardless of size, shall be submitted ex-ante to the Bank for approval;
(e) The Borrower may submit to the Bank one or more Allocation Requests with respectto COVID-19 Component as per Schedule A (bis) in compliance with the allocation procedures set out in Schedule A(bis)1 .5;
(f) Each Allocation Request in relation to any Schemes under the COVID-19 Component as per Schedule A (bis) shall indicate whether such Scheme is classified under the Health or Civil Protection sectors; and
(g) Schemes allocated under the COVID-19 Component as per Schedule A (bis) shall be implemented between 1 February 2020 and 31 December 2021.
The Borrower shall provide the Bank with any additional information regarding the Schemes as the Bank, at its own discretion, may request.
If the Allocation Request or the Schemes under (c) above are confirmed/approved by the Bank, the Bank shall deliver to the Borrower a letter of allocation (“Allocation Letter”), informing the Borrower of its confirmation/approval and of the amount of the Credit allocated. lf the Bank requires additional information regarding the Schemes included in the Allocation Request, the period to deliver the Allocation Letter will be suspended until such additional information is provided to the satisfaction of the Bank.
In the event the Bank does not approve fully or partially the Allocation Request, the Bank shall inform the Borrower thereof in writing within the same period.
The Bank reserves the right to review with the Borrower the allocation procedures in view of the development of the Project.
The Bank may by notice to the Borrower amend the Allocation Procedure as described in this Article 1 .9A to bring it into line with the Bank’s policy or reflect the results of the review of the implementation capacity and performance. In such case, the Bank shall inform the Borrower thereof and the Borrower shall promptly adapt its internal allocation procedures accordingly.”
